Learning Objectives
5 objectives- Understand the fundamental concepts and importance of property valuation in real estate.
- Analyze factors that influence property value and their impact on valuation.
- Compare and apply different property valuation methods appropriately.
- Conduct market analysis and research to support accurate property valuations.
- Recognize legal, ethical, and specialized considerations in property appraisal.
